Broken hinges

Bifold doors are a fantastic option to add storage and functionality to your closet. However, like every other kind of door they are susceptible to problems over time. Hinges can break or misalign. It can be difficult to open and close your doors. Professional repair services can realign bifold doors to restore their functionality.

In addition to the aesthetic benefits of doors that shut smoothly Bifold door repairs could improve the energy efficiency of your home. Correctly aligned doors stop air leaks and drafts, which reduces your heating and cooling expenses. This can save you a lot of money over time.

The bottom rollers of your bifold doors could become damaged if they rub against the floor too often. If your bifold door is rubbing against the carpet, you could try to raise it by altering the bottom pivot adjustment. If you can't fix the issue with this method, you may have to replace the bottom rollers with a new set.

Squeaky hinges are another common issue with bifold doors. While squeaky hinges can be irritating, they are generally easy to repair. First, you should clean the area around the hinge hole and remove any material that is loose or crumbling. Cut a thin piece of hardboard or plywood that is a bit larger than the hinge plate to be used as a support. Apply a generous amount wood glue to the back of the plate, and then press it into the hinge holes. Clamp it in place and let it dry for at least a day before you use the door once more.

Broken rollers

The bifold door is a fantastic alternative to make space in your wardrobe. They are prone to fall off their tracks and cause serious damage. To avoid this you can make simple adjustments to keep your door on track. These suggestions are easy for anyone who is a homeowner.

The examination of the roller wheels is the initial step to repair a damaged bifolding door. As time passes, the roller wheels may begin to lose their shape and create high friction with the tracks. This could lead to the wheels dragging up and down the track rather than rolling. This could cause serious damage and may require replacements.

It is also possible to check if the tracks are straight and level. If they're not level, it could be due to an issue with your guide rails. The guide rails serve to keep your doors in place and help them slide effortlessly. The rails can be damaged or misaligned, and cause other issues. They could even break.

A loud, grinding or popping sound when your door opens and shuts is another indication that the rollers require repair. This is usually caused by rusty steel rollers. The problem is usually solved through lubrication. However, should it continue to persist, you might need to replace the rollers.

If your door has locks, you should also examine the locks to ensure that they're secure. Over time, locks may become loose or rusted and make it difficult to lock and unlock your door. If this happens it is necessary to lubricate the locks and clean them. You can also apply silicone spray to to lubricate the rollers and hinges.
